Some secrets cannot be kept. Their effects are too great for the cause to remain unknown. Unfortunately, these secrets are often the ones we would die before we tell.

They say honesty is the best policy. Perhaps in a better world, with better people, honesty would work. You could say how you really felt, or what really happened, or all manner of truthful observations - just as everyone else would. The world would move much more quickly. You would never have to stop and decipher truth from lie or decipher hidden agendas or secret motives. We would all just function as we did, openly and honestly.

But let's get real. Honesty sucks. Our world is flawed. We use lies to make it easier. A little white lie to smooth over a bump of truth that might hurt. A medium sized lie to save ourselves from an embarrassing situation. Or those really big ones that we need to tell ourselves to get through the day.

The first two aren't so bad. The third one - those are where the trouble becomes. Those are the ones that grow too large to be contained. Because as much as we need to lie about it to be able to carry on - that is just how much it slowly kills us to carry it.

I know. I have secrets like that.

Don't scoff at me. I hate when people scoff at me. I hate to not be taken seriously. I may be blonde. I may be cute. I may be young. But none of these make my life and my experiences any less real.

I know. First question: 'What secrets could a pretty girl like you harbor?'

I hate this question.

Second question: 'Why tell them now?'

This is a better question. This is a question worth answering.
